Q1.What are the typical services offered by funeral homes in Lost Springs, Kansas?

Funeral homes in Lost Springs typically offer traditional services such as visitations, funeral ceremonies, and graveside services, often coordinated with local churches or community centers. Many also provide cremation services, memorial planning, and assistance with obituaries for local papers like the Marion County Record. Given the small-town setting, they often emphasize personalized, community-focused support for families.

Q2.How much does a funeral typically cost in Lost Springs, KS?

In Lost Springs, a traditional funeral with burial can range from $7,000 to $10,000, depending on services selected. Costs are influenced by Kansas state regulations and local provider fees, with cremation often being a more affordable option starting around $2,000. It's advisable to request detailed price lists from local funeral homes to compare options specific to Marion County.

Q3.Are there any local regulations in Lost Springs or Kansas that affect burial or cremation?

Yes, Kansas state law requires a 24-hour waiting period before cremation and a permit for burial or cremation issued by the local registrar. In Lost Springs, burials typically occur in local cemeteries like the Lost Springs Cemetery, and funeral homes must comply with Marion County health and zoning regulations. It's best to consult a local funeral director for specific requirements.

Q4.How do I choose a funeral home in Lost Springs, and what should I consider?

Consider factors like reputation within the small community, range of services (e.g., traditional burial vs. cremation), and cost transparency. In Lost Springs, you might also evaluate proximity to local cemeteries and whether the funeral home offers personalized touches reflective of the town's rural character. Asking for recommendations from neighbors or checking with local churches can help in making a decision.

Q5.Can I pre-plan a funeral in Lost Springs, KS, and what are the benefits?

Yes, many funeral homes in Lost Springs offer pre-planning services, allowing you to arrange details in advance and lock in current prices. Under Kansas law, pre-paid funeral funds are protected in trust accounts. This can ease the burden on family members and ensure your wishes are met within the local community context.

As you consider your options, it's helpful to know what services local funeral homes typically provide. Most offer a complete range, from immediate care and preparation to helping you plan a visitation, funeral, or memorial service. They can assist with vital paperwork, such as obtaining death certificates and filing for benefits. Importantly, they also offer various forms of final disposition, including traditional burial, often in one of our beautiful local cemeteries, and cremation services. Many homes now provide options for personalization, such as memory tables, tribute videos, or custom urns, allowing you to celebrate a unique life story.
